#0e9984 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0e9984 is composed of 5.5% red, 60%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 13.7%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 170.9 degrees, a saturation of 83.2% and a lightness of 32.7%. #0e9984 color hex could be obtained by blending #1cffff with #003309. Closest websafe color is: #009999.

Shades and Tints of #0e9984
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010908 is the darkest color, while #f6fefd is the lightest one.
